I think it is a good work, the line art is very good and it is obvious that it took a lot of effort. Things that you could improve are: 1-keep the light source consistent. You have light coming from all over with no real direction. Also she does not seem to be casting a shadow on where she is crouching. Also keep the light the same color for all the image. 2-A good way of getting your background not to compete with your focal point is to keep the saturation down. Also remember aerial perspective, when the background recede it gets bluer. Hope this helps! I think you did a very good job!
